WebDec 17, 2010 · In photonic crystals, the phase velocity of an electromagnetic wave moving through the crystal is controlled by tuning the photonic band structure; the impedance is determined by the electromagnetic field distributions throughout the material. Shen, "Nonlinear Optical Spectroscopy of Photonic Metamaterials," in Conference on Lasers and Electro-Optics/Quantum Electronics and … A photonic metamaterial (PM), also known as an optical metamaterial, is a type of electromagnetic metamaterial, that interacts with light, covering terahertz (THz), infrared (IR) or visible wavelengths. The materials employ a periodic, cellular structure.
